Andy Erickson, PhD, PE, is a Research Manager at the University of Minnesota's St. Anthony Falls Laboratory, part of the College of Science and Engineering. He holds a PhD in Civil Engineering from the University of Minnesota (2017), an MS from the same institution (2005), and a BS from Michigan Technological University (2002). His work focuses on stormwater treatment, urban water quality, and innovative technologies like the Iron-Enhanced Sand Filter.
- Chair of the ASTM International E64 Committee on Stormwater Control Measures
- Chair of the University of Minnesota Water Council
- Member of multiple university committees and programs, including the Civil, Environmental, and Geo-Engineering Graduate Faculty
Research interests include urban and agricultural watershed management, stormwater assessment, and climate change adaptation. Erickson has authored a handbook on stormwater practices and leads the Minnesota Stormwater Seminar Series. He has secured grants for projects like the Upper Mississippi River Water Availability Assessment and studies on vegetation management near roads.
Notable achievements include over 240 presentations, 30 guest lectures, and 40 professional trainings. He serves as editor of the stormwater newsletter UPDATES and is a Fellow at the Institute on the Environment.
